Really enjoyed our stay at Le Sabot this September! It's an "open-air concept" due to the accommodation being made out of bamboo which allows fresh air into it. There are still windows with glass and doors that close, so you have privacy, but there is no aircon. We were worried about the heat however it was completely fine. In fact, I had my best sleep in Bali while at Le Sabot! The 2 fans were perfect and the mosquito net over the bed kept any bugs out. We are travellers on an economical budget but by no means are we backpackers, and we were very comfortable. The 2 pools are lovely and refreshing too.

It's worth noting that the accommodation, like the others in the area, can only be reached by scooter / on foot. (The road is abobut 200m away) This is perfectly fine as the accommodation has scooters to rent to you and also meets you at the drop-off point to carry your bags for you, however if you're someone who struggles with mobility, doesn't know how to ride a scooter, or will be afraid of walking along a path at night, then you might feel uneasy.

Stayed in the one bedroom villa. It was beautifully decorated and looks just like the pictures on the inside. Warning though, it is NOT any of the bamboo huts you see in the picture. It is a normal brick building towards the back of the property away from the pool. Even though there is no aircon, there is good airflow through the room so it stayed a good temperature for sleeping. The shower had good water pressure and the mattress was very comfortable.

The place was lovely, I just feel a bit fooled because I thought I'd be staying in a bamboo hut but it was just a normal building. It was still very lovely and peaceful. The roosters are quite loud in the morning though and someone was burning something outside so it smelled like fire sometime at night but not too bad. Also, since it is very open to the outdoors, you can expect mosquitos, geckos, and the occasional cockroach. It's normal for Asia though. There was a fair amount of gecko poop in the shower area though.
